Key steps to be followed for registering a company are:
- Applying for a unique company name at Business Registrations and Licensing Agency (BRELA)
- Obtaining a notarized declaration of compliance with the requirements for formation of the company
- Applying for incorporation of company alongwith relevant documents and obtaining the certificate of incorporation from Registrar of Companies
- Obtaining taxpayer identification number (TIN) from Tanzania Revenue Authority (TRA)
- Applying for a business license from either the Ministry of Industry and Trade (MIT) or Local Government Authorities (LGAs), depending on the nature of business
- Applying for VAT certificate from TRA
- Registering the company for the Workmen’s Compensation Insurance and the Occupational Safety and Health Authority (OSHA)
- Obtaining Social Security registration number from Social Security Regulatory Authority (SSRA)
For setting-up a branch of a foreign company, following documents are required:
- A certified copy of the charter, statutes or memorandum and articles of the foreign company or other instrument constituting or defining the constitution of the foreign company
- A list containing particulars of the directors and secretary of the foreign company
- A statement of subsisting charges created by the company related to property located in Tanzania
- Names and addresses of one or more persons resident in Tanzania authorized to act as the company’s representative
- Full address of the registered principal place of business and place of business in Tanzania
- A statutory declaration made by a director or secretary of the company stating the date on which the company’s place of business was established in Tanzania and the business that is to be carried out
- A copy of the recent financial statements of the foreign company
